    Dear fellow members I was born just to the west of London shortly after the second world war. Like most Britons at the time we were very poor. Food rationing continued for some time after the war right up to 1954 just after the coronation of Queen Elizabeth II. I was five years old before I saw a sweet or a bar of chocolate but we sometimes had biscuits. There was a friend of our family who was an Author and he told me once that if a story was told well it could be about absolutely anything and still be a joy to read. When I retired a short while ago I decided to write a book. It will be a pleasure to share my efforts with others.
